Crimson is the tenth studio album by Japanese singer Akina Nakamori. It was released on 24 December 1986 under the Warner Pioneer label. The album includes the original version of Eki.

It was her first album to work with mostly female songwriters such as Mariya Takeuchi and Akiko Kobayashi who primarily composed of this album.

Four months after the release of Fushigi which was subtly experimental and eccentric, Nakamori returned to a conventional sound except with the experimentation of Mick Jagger Ni Hohoemio that was experimented with sound effects such as typewriting, stirring and playing an cassette tape, also Nakamori sings in a quieter, whispering tone as usually she vocalized herself with the use of falsetto.

Crimson was considered by critics it as a essential city pop album and becoming her most commercially successful album at that time.
